Manager Operator information

What is a manager operator?

Manager Operators are professionals responsible for overseeing and coordinating the daily operations of a department, facility, or business unit. They ensure that processes run efficiently, resources are allocated effectively, and organizational goals are met. Their duties often include supervising staff, implementing policies, managing budgets, and optimizing workflows. Manager Operators play a crucial role in maintaining productivity and addressing any issues that arise within their area of responsibility.

What does a manager operator do?

Manager Operators are often required to oversee daily operations while also leading and supporting their teams. This balance usually involves setting clear priorities, delegating tasks appropriately, and maintaining open communication channels. Manager Operators spend part of their day addressing operational issues directly and another part focused on coaching team members, monitoring performance, and ensuring safety and quality standards. This dual focus can be challenging but also provides strong opportunities for skill development and advancement into higher management roles.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a manager operator?

To thrive as a Manager Operator, you need strong leadership, operational management, and problem-solving skills, often supported by a degree in business, management, or a related field. Familiarity with industry-specific management software, workflow systems, and safety regulations is typically required. Excellent communication, decision-making, and team-building abilities help set top performers apart in this role. These skills and qualities are crucial for ensuring efficient operations, maintaining safety standards, and driving team productivity.

What is the difference between Manager Operator vs Machine Operator?

AspectManager OperatorMachine Operator
CredentialsTypically requires management experience and technical skills, sometimes certifications in machinery or safetyUsually requires technical training or certification specific to machinery operation
Work EnvironmentSupervises teams, oversees operations, and ensures safety complianceOperates machinery directly, often in manufacturing or industrial settings
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in manufacturing, production, and industrial sectors for overseeing operationsFound in factories, plants, and industrial facilities for machine operation

The main difference between a Manager Operator and a Machine Operator is that the Manager Operator combines operational oversight with management responsibilities, while the Machine Operator focuses solely on operating machinery. The Manager Operator typically has additional credentials and supervises teams, whereas the Machine Operator specializes in the technical operation of equipment.

Forklift Operator

Permanent Full-Time

Abbotsford, BC

Reference Number: NWP-BC-ABB-129-040826

SUMMARY

Reporting to the Plant Manager, the Forklift Operator is responsible for efficiently and accurately assembling products for orders, loading orders onto trucks, loading and unloading production equipment and trucks as necessary.

EXPECTED CONTRIBUTIONS

  • Loads and unloads building material supplies safely and promptly on and off delivery trucks.
  • Accurately, efficiently, and safely picks and assembles customer orders for staging.
  • Set up lumber for wrapping.
  • Assists in general labour tasks as required.
  • Maintains a clean and organized yard.
  • Adheres to all work safety rules and regulations.
  • Adheres to customer service commitments.

Requirements

K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, AND ABILITIES

  • Certification is required on a counterbalance forklift (8,000 to 18,000 lb capacity).
  • Minimum one (1) year experience is required.
  • Experience working in a lumber mill or lumber yard is desirable.
  • Must have own steel-toed boots.
  • Must be familiar with pulling and staging orders.
  • Able to lift up to 50 pounds or 23 kilograms.
  • Bending, lifting, and reaching during the course of the shift.
  • First Aid Certificate is an asset.
  • Must be able to speak, read, and write English.

EMPLOYMENT STATUS:  Permanent Full-Time

Benefits

COMPENSATION AND BENEFITS

  • Hourly Rate - $24 per hour
  • Health Benefits
  • Option to purchase Doman stock at a discounted price

Hours of Work: Monday to Friday, 7:30am - 3:30pm

NOTE: Hours may change due to operational requirements.

Work Location:  33730 Enterprise Avenue, Abbotsford, BC  V2S 7T9. 

Transportation:  Must have own reliable transportation.  The site is not located on a bus route.
